Our verdict is Benign. Variant got -15 ACMG points: 0P and 15B. BP4_ModerateBP6_Very_StrongBP7BS2
The NM_006206.6(PDGFRA):c.2613C>T(p.Leu871Leu)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000119 in 1,428,296 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).
